Things have changed for the better. These handy little throws are inexpensive and seem so far to work very well. Especially for track switches that don't get thrown very often if at all. They won't work everywhere. If you have a switch hidden or out of reach of your hand or that needs to be thrown all the time you might consider a remote powered switch throw. There's no reason to spend a lot of time and money on powered switch throws if they are little used. Just be careful when installing that they have have an ample and unhindered path of travel so the tiny plastic gears don't strip out.
